What is a Stock Issuance Agreement?
A Stock Issuance Agreement is a foundational legal document that outlines the details of stock shares being issued by a corporation. This document specifies crucial terms such as the number of shares, purchase price, and other relevant conditions. It is vital for 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ements and protecting both the issuer's and the investor's interests.

Typical industries and workflows that depend on Stock Issuance Agreements
Industries such as finance, legal, and startups commonly rely on Stock Issuance Agreements. In these sectors, the agreements facilitate investment rounds, track ownership stakes, and comply with SEC regulations for public offerings. Workflows generally involve collaboration among legal teams, compliance officers, and investors to ensure all terms meet legal standards and stakeholders' expectations.
